Diabetic diet


The diabetic diet can be defined as a healthy food plan which has rich sources of nutrients and has low calories and fats. A healthy diet always includes fruits, vegetables, and whole grains. Usually, a diabetic diet is suggested for people with type 2 diabetes mellitus. The diet plan is designed in such a way that it prevents the fluctuation of glucose levels in the blood.

Foods best for people with diabetes:

Oatmeal – Digests slower than the processed carbohydrates, prevents the release of glucose into the bloodstream slower and prevents the fluctuations in blood sugar levels.

Grapes  Having fruits specifically grapes, blueberries and apples have shown lowering the risk of type 2 diabetes.

Olive oil – Improves insulin sensitivity as it contains monounsaturated fats, also helps to zap belly fat.

Eggs – Provides a great dose of proteins. People with diabetes are advised limited yolk three times a week.

Dairy -  Having calcium, magnesium, cheese, yogurt, and vitamin- D makes your body sensitive to insulin.

Kale – Rich in nutrients such as magnesium and vitamin – K, helps in controlling the blood sugar levels.

Fish – the Best source for people with high blood levels with omega- 3 fatty acids.

Cranberries – Contains large amounts of phytonutrients. Anthocyanins one of the nutrients especially good for diabetes.

Quinoa  Contains all nine essential amino acids. Help reduce fluctuations in blood sugar levels.

Apples – 40% of the bad cholesterol can be lowered by eating apples and lowers the risk of type 2 diabetes.

Red onions – Contain antioxidants, high in fiber, potassium, and folate which are good for the heart.

Nuts   Contains Vitamin – E, unsaturated fats, omega – 3 fatty acids, fibers, plant sterols etc., which help arteries less prone to blood clots.

Asparagus – Contains high antioxidant called glutathione which reduces the effect of many diseases including diabetes. Increase the insulin production and keeps blood levels in check.
